Investigation Summary
At approximately 6:35 p.m. on January 23, 2015, an employee was switching one of the line carts carrying a trailer due to a malfunction on the wheels. The damaged line cart needed to be replaced with a functional line cart. The back of the trailer was lifted by a single powered industrial truck to remove the damaged line cart while the front end of the trailer remained on a functional line cart. Once elevated, the trailer rolled ahead and slid off the forks of the powered industrial truck. The employee was underneath the trailer at the time the trailer slid and was crushed and killed by the trailer. The employee died from multiple blunt force injuries.
Keywords: Crushed, Falling Object, Powered Industrial Vehicle, Roll-Over, Struck By, Unstable Load
